| 59 Golden Orb Weaver Norfolk Island is home to many species of insects. Beetles, moths, ants, spiders, bees and butterflies abound; many of which are unclassified and unstudied. Interestingly, there are no fatal creatures on land: no poisonous spiders, and no snakes.
